From 19001dc7c28c750d3dbf0086f5bcac2d11ad592f Mon Sep 17 00:00:00 2001 From: Paul Olav Tvete Date: Thu, 26 Jul 2018 15:54:19 +0200 Subject: Handle subsurfaces added before QWaylandQuickItem created This makes gstreamer and Firefox work with QML-based compositors. Task-number: QTBUG-69643 Change-Id: Iaddaeb7dc3493a262993eecc5ea0b6ce076b4044 Reviewed-by: Johan Helsing --- src/compositor/compositor_api/qwaylandsurface_p.h | 2 ++ 1 file changed, 2 insertions(+) (limited to 'src/compositor/compositor_api/qwaylandsurface_p.h') diff --git a/src/compositor/compositor_api/qwaylandsurface_p.h b/src/compositor/compositor_api/qwaylandsurface_p.h index 0cb12d15b..e0b624fce 100644 --- a/src/compositor/compositor_api/qwaylandsurface_p.h +++ b/src/compositor/compositor_api/qwaylandsurface_p.h @@ -163,6 +163,8 @@ public: //member variables QList pendingFrameCallbacks; QList frameCallbacks; + QList> subsurfaceChildren; + QRegion inputRegion; QRegion opaqueRegion; -- cgit v1.2.3